How IP Geolocation Works and the Limits for This Address
Geolocation of an IP address relies on a layered approach that combines network registration data, routing information, and public or private databases to approximate the device’s geographic location; however, the precision and reliability of these estimates vary significantly.

What Are Common Misclassifications for This IP?
Common misclassification often arises from outdated WHOIS data and regional routing changes; IP ownership changes complicate attribution. An analytical approach reveals inconsistencies between registries, RIR records, and AS-level announcements, underscoring the need for cross-source verification and timing awareness.
